Bengaluru: The Karnataka BJP launched an online campaign against the ruling Congress, dubbing it the “Congress Gang”.

It mockingly appealed to the people to contact the Congress party leaders to execute contract killing, to commit murder, to issue threats and for abetting suicides in the state.

Attaching the office address of the Karnataka Pradesh Congress Committee in its post, it asked the people to approach these leaders --(Deputy Chief Minister) D K Shivakumar to issue threats; (Former minister) Vinay Kulkarni for committing murder; (Rural Development and Panchayat Raj Minister) Priyank Kharge for supari (Contract) for abetting suicide; Women and Child Development Minister Lakshmi Hebbalkar for committing MLA’s murder. (Chief Minister) Siddaramaiah for farmers and officers’ deaths; (Health and Family Welfare Minister) Dinesh Gundu Rao for committing murder in hospitals; (Planning and Statistics Minister) D Sudhkar for attacking Dalits; (Hungund Congress MLA) Vijayananad Kashappanavar for attacking the police and (Karnataka  Housing Board Chairman) K M Shivalinge Gowda for using abusive language against the police officers.

BJP’s sarcastic post comes after the Congress posted a video clip of the Leader of the Opposition R Ashoka, accusing him of using abusive language against the police officers who tried to convince him not to protest at the Majestic Bus Stand after the government hiked bus fare by 15 per cent.
